Spring Fever - Planning for summer museum visits

Wow! One more week of school and the summer stretches out before us. We need something to do. Museums are going to be part of the mix but in what way?

What are the needs of a family audience in the summer, and how can museums meet them?


Affordability
  • With a lot of days to fill, parents cannot afford to spend a lot on any one activity.
  • Transportation, lunch, and souvenirs all factor into the bottom line. 
Family oriented
  • Programs and activities should be age appropriate while engaging the whole family. Unless there are activities at the same time for different ages, it is a struggle to entertain one child while the older or younger has his/her program.
Convenience
  • How do we get there? Where will we park? Are there food options nearby? What times are available for programs? Will it conflict with nap time?
Content
  • What is the program about? How will it be conducted? How relevant is it to our experience?
